Hello everybody,
In the following code I don't understand why integral2 doesn't work. Could you suggest me a solution to achieve the integration? Currently I am calculating many values with vpa and then I use twice trapz to make it work but it takes really long and the accuracy is not very good...
Thank you in advance
clear all
WaveFunction = @(x) exp(-x.^2./2)./pi.^(0.25);
expression1 = @(x,p,y) exp(-i.*p.*y).* WaveFunction(x-y./2).* conj(WaveFunction(x+y./2));
syms y
WignerFunction = @(x,p) 1/(2.*pi).* int(expression1(x,p,y),y,-Inf,Inf);
t = isa(WignerFunction,'function_handle') % outputs 1
%vpa(WignerFunction(1,1)) % outputs the correct value
t = integral2(WignerFunction,-Inf,Inf,-Inf,Inf) % should output 1
